The SL 72 may lack the notoriety of the Samba but it still carries its own claim to fame. In fact, it has more than one …
The design debuted ahead of the 1972 Summer Olympics in Munich, arriving as one of the first Adidas models to showcase the brand’s now-iconic Trefoil logo.
It was also a favorite of the late Bob Marley, a connection that prompted Adidas to release a one-off version adorned with the artist’s signature.

Since then, the Sl 72 has found its way into the rotation of high-profile supermodels — not to mention the top of the Lyst Index — with Harper’s Bazaar calling it the “hottest sneaker of 2025” coming in into the new year.
